Ticket: GATE-511 — Rate-limit config push to the Coppervane internal gateway rejected: signature check failed. Cause: config bundle signed with the retired Q3 key after rotation. No tampering indicators; hash matches source. Limiter rules themselves unchanged except burst window (30s to 10s). Security review requested before re-push. Rollback path verified. Audit log attached in thread. Re-signing requires the current deploy key, provided below.

release key, fahaf-bajof: bky3_Xam

**Ticket: Config drift on export retry workers**

The Draftport export retry workers in region B are running different retry settings than region A. Region B was hand-patched during the March incident and never reconciled. Result: customers in B see exports marked failed after three attempts while A retries eight times. Support should flag any retry complaints with region before escalating. Fix is scheduled next sprint. The intended canonical values, for reference, are these.

deployment values, taduf-fawig:
WENAEL_HOST=wenael.zemvarlabs.internal
WENAEL_PORT=8443

Nice work on the Quillview contrast audit pass. One request before merge: please document why the warning threshold sits below the failure threshold rather than at the spec minimum — future maintainers will assume WCAG values otherwise. Also note that the sampler skips decorative glyphs by design, not oversight. For reference, the thresholds the checker currently enforces are listed below.

limits module of fajog-tawig:
RATE_LIMITS = {
    "druwyn": 2,
    "quenael": 10,
    "wenix": 2,
    "druael": 2,
}

**Ticket: Config drift — log sampling on `chirpd`**

The chirpd service on the Fennmoor cluster is emitting full-volume logs again. Someone hand-edited the sampling rate during an incident and never reverted it, so staging and prod have drifted apart. Until the drift check is automated, maintainers should reconcile both environments against the canonical values shown below.

config for kafof-bawef:
holath:
  log_level: debug
  metrics_host: metrics.holath.qorvelsys.internal
  pin: 2191
  pool_size: 32